Whenever I change a page layout, or add a field or picklist values, I literally have to hit refresh on the page 20 times before it finally reflects it which I don't even think does anything. I read online in Chrome if you press CTRL-F5 it forces a full refresh but that still does nothing.  Usually the page just eventually updates 5 mins later if you leave it, but it's wasting time.

 

I just added 2 values to a pick list field 10 mins ago, and am refreshing and refreshing and still it doesn't show the values.  I just logged in here, wrote this whole message, and finally now it has updated to show them.  So almost 10 minutes hitting refresh at least 10 times before it updated.  It's not my PC either as I use 3 different machines, they all do it, Edge, Chrome, etc.  I've seen many other people complaining about this but curious how people deal with it.

    Lee, Salesforce implements an aggressive caching policy for the LEX framework to reduce the turnaround time from the server which causes grave refresh issues when working with Lightning. Thanks to this simple setting (that I was totally unaware of) which can help you deal with this issue:

    Enable secure and persistent browser caching to improve performance

    Uncheck it if it's already checked.

     

    You can find it under Setup-> Session Settings -> Caching section
